Appropriate Preposition:

  • Tell upon ( ক্ষতি করা ) Over-eating tells upon health.
  • Wish for ( আকাঙ্খা করা ) I do not wish for name and fame.
  • Hard of ( কম শোনা ) He is hard of hearing.
  • Dull of ( বোধশক্তিহীন ) He is dull of understanding.
  • Composed of ( তৈরি ) Water is composed of Hydrogen and Oxygen.
  • Ignorant of ( অজ্ঞ ) He is ignorant of this rule.

Idioms:

  • At stake ( বিপন্ন ) His life is at stake now.
  • At large ( স্বাধীন ) The anti-socials are still at large.
  • In vain ( বৃথা ) All his attempts were in vain.
  • All on a sudden ( হঠাৎ ) All on a sudden a tiger came out of the bush.
  • Come off with flying colours ( জয়লাভ করা ) Our School team came off with flying colours.
  • By fits and starts ( অনিয়মিত ; মাঝে মাঝে ) He works by fits and starts.
